Originally Posted by dsleedesign
This is what I got.
225/45R 18 Michelin X-Ice

You are saying that this is slightly wrong.... will it still work?

Will I have any issues?
Should be fine. What you have is 0.8% larger than standard, so your speedometer and odometer will read slightly low while you have them installed. There may be a way to adjust the readings with VCDS, but my laptop is on a different continent right now, so I can't check. Here's a useful comparison tool:

https://tiresize.com/calculator/

Originally Posted by dsleedesign
i geezus.... i just read this post.... i have not been here in a while... (enjoying my TT).

So did I buy the wrong tires/rims?

This is what I got.
225/45R 18 Michelin X-Ice

You are saying that this is slightly wrong.... will it still work?

Will I have any issues?
Yes, this is the wrong size, but not by much.

225/45/18 = 25.97" overall diameter
245/40/18 = 25.72" overall diameter

If you haven't mounted the tires yet, you should swap them for the correct size.
